Geological Problems Reported
Some small faults were reported southwest of the shaft, whose offsets were enough to require grading some of the haulage routes. The roof was 20 feet of gray shale that contained small sandy oblong nodules. The coal contained lenses of pyrite and streaks of gypsum. Some pyrite nodules were present and difficult to remove from the coal. Fusain (“mother coal”) was also present in streaks and bands. The impurities were generally highest in the center of the seam. The floor was a dark gray, carbonaceous fire clay that heaved when exposed to air, and heaved badly when it became wet. This clay was also mined for brick production. In the south and southwest areas of the mine, sandstone was encountered which halted mining efforts in those areas.
